East Anglia Rail Disruption Expected Amidst Soaring Temperatures

Train passengers in East Anglia are advised to anticipate significant disruption due to the current hot weather conditions. Speed restrictions are being implemented across the network to ensure safety, potentially causing delays and alterations to services.

Scorching temperatures are set to bring East Anglia's railway network to its limits, with speed restrictions introduced on key lines amid fears of track damage. Network Rail has taken precautionary measures to mitigate the risk of rails buckling under the extreme heat, which could lead to delays and service alterations.

The UK-wide heatwave poses a particular challenge for East Anglia's railway infrastructure, where steel tracks are vulnerable to expansion in high temperatures. Without speed restrictions, there is an increased risk of 'sun kinks' – rails bending or buckling, potentially leading to derailments and safety hazards.

Operators serving the region, including Greater Anglia, will be affected by the restrictions, with passengers advised to check their journeys before travelling. Those using routes connecting major towns and cities, as well as those commuting to London, can expect longer journey times and are urged to allow extra time for travel.

Network Rail engineers are closely monitoring track temperatures and working to minimise disruption while prioritising passenger safety above all else. The hot weather measures will remain in place until temperatures pose no risk to the integrity of the railway lines, with regular reviews conducted based on prevailing conditions.

This is not the first time East Anglia's rail network has faced challenges due to extreme weather, highlighting the ongoing need for investment in heat-resilient infrastructure and adaptive operational strategies to ensure future reliability.

Why this matters: Disruption to East Anglia's rail network affects thousands of daily commuters and leisure travellers, impacting work schedules and travel plans across a vital economic region. It also highlights the broader challenge of maintaining infrastructure resilience against changing climate patterns in the UK.
